Sheringham’s station adopter in Norfolk has big plans to brighten up the new station platform with flowers.
Sheila McGinley has worked with Greater Anglia, Sheringham’s local rail operator, to install three wooden planters, which she will fill with plants.
The planters also replace the old station garden, which was lost when the platform had to be extended to allow the new fleet of trains to stop at the station.
More than £1m was invested by Greater Anglia in the project, which saw improved LED lighting and a new passenger shelter installed at the station.
Greater Anglia’s Customer and Community Engagement Manager, Alan Neville, said, “I’m pleased that we have been able to work with Sheila to bring some attractive floral displays back to Sheringham station, to help provide a more welcoming environment to everyone who uses the station.”
